Definition: Balsa is a type of lightweight wood that comes from the balsa tree, scientifically known as Ochroma pyramidale. It is known for its low density and exceptional buoyancy, making it a popular choice for various applications, including model building, crafts, and even aerospace engineering.

Origin:
The word “balsa” originated from the Spanish language, where it means “raft” or “float.” It refers to the wood’s natural buoyancy and its traditional use in making rafts. The balsa tree is native to South America, particularly the tropical regions of Brazil, Ecuador, and Peru.
